The 10th annual Zora Neale Hurston and Richard Wright Legacy Awards for outstanding contributions to literature by African American writers were presented November 10th at a ceremony in Oxon Hill, Maryland. The fiction award was presented to Danielle Evans for Before You Suffocate Your Own Fool Self (Riverhead); the poetry prize went to Elizabeth Alexander for Crave Radiance (Graywolf Press) and the nonfiction winner is Isabel Wilkerson for The Warmth of other Suns (Random House).

In addition the Hurston/Wright North Star Award went to poet, novelist and essayist Amiri Baraka and The Hurston/Wright Ella Baker Award for civic support of black Literature was presented to Roberta McLeod. The Hurston/Wright Foundation is a nonprofit resource center for readers, writers and supporters of Black literature.
